Abstract

The utility model discloses an aging device of LED lamp beads, which comprises a power supply host, an aging box and a safety cover; the aging box is arranged on the power supply host, and is provided with a test circuit which is electrically connected with the power supply host; the test circuit is provided with a first power switch and a plurality of second power switches, and when the first power switch and the second power switches are closed simultaneously, the test circuit is connected with the power supply host; when any one of the first power switch and the second power switch is disconnected, the connection between the test circuit and the power supply host is in a disconnected state; the safety cover is covered on the aging box; when the safety cover is covered on the aging box, the second power switch is closed; when the safety cover is far away from the aging box, the second power switch is switched off. The utility model discloses when ageing equipment operation, test circuit department does not have the danger of electrocuting in ageing oven and safety cover, has improved the factor of safety of equipment.

Aging equipment for LED lamp beads
Technical Field
The utility model relates to a LED illumination lamps and lanterns detect technical field, in particular to ageing equipment of LED lamp pearl.
Background
The LED lamp bead has the advantages of environmental protection, energy conservation, long service life and the like, and is widely popularized and applied in various fields.
Like other electronic products, the LED lamp beads need to be subjected to aging tests in the research and development and production processes so as to eliminate possible faults in the use process.
At present, in order to put the LED lamp beads into the aging equipment conveniently and observe whether the LED lamp beads can be lightened or not in the aging test process, an aging panel circuit of the aging equipment of the LED lamp beads is exposed outside. The circuit is exposed outside, and in the testing process, if the circuit is accidentally touched with the aging panel circuit, on one hand, the risk of electric shock is caused, especially when the aging test is carried out on the high-voltage LED lamp bead (the LED lamp bead with the working voltage exceeding 36V); on the other hand, testing may be affected. Moreover, the circuit is exposed, which easily causes circuit damage.

Detailed Description
The present invention will be described in further detail with reference to fig. 1 to 4.
Referring to fig. 1, the utility model discloses an ageing equipment of LED lamp pearl, including host computer 1, ageing oven 2 and safety cover 3.
Referring to fig. 2, the power supply main unit 1 supplies power to the burn-in box 2 for a burn-in test, and monitors the operation of the burn-in box 2. The power supply main body 1 is provided with a first power switch button 10.
The aging box 2 is a rectangular box body without a cover, and the aging box 2 is arranged on the power supply host 1. An aging board 21 is arranged in the box body of the aging box 2, a test circuit 22 is distributed on the aging board 21, and the test circuit 22 is electrically connected with the power supply host 1.
Referring to fig. 3, the test circuit 22 is provided with a first power switch 221 and a plurality of second power switches 222, the first power switch 221 being disposed directly below the first power switch button 10, and the first power switch 221 being opened or closed by pressing the first power switch button 10. The first power switch 221 and the second power switch 222 can both be connected or disconnected between the test circuit 22 and the power supply host 1, only when the first power switch 221 and the second power switch 222 are simultaneously closed, the test circuit 22 is connected, and the aging device starts an aging test; when any one of the first power switch 221 and the second power switch 222 is turned off, the connection between the test circuit 22 and the power supply is in an off state.
The second power switch 222 is a gravity switch.
The aging plate 21 is provided with a plurality of switch holes 23, and the switch holes 23 are arranged at four corners of the aging plate 21, are correspondingly arranged right above the second power switch 222, and are communicated with the second power switch 222.
Referring to fig. 4, the safety cap 3 is a rectangular cap including a rectangular frame 31, a top cap 32, a connection plate 33, and a pressure probe 34. The top cap 32 is made by glass, and the top cap 32 is fixed at the top of rectangle frame 31, can observe whether LED lamp pearl shines in ageing oven 2 through top cap 32. The connecting plate 33 is a flat plate, and the connecting plate 33 is arranged parallel to the top cover 32, fixed at the bottom of the rectangular frame 31, and extends into the rectangular frame 31. The pressure probe 34 is vertically fixed on the connection plate 33 and extends in a direction away from the top cover 32, and the position of the pressure probe 34 corresponds to the switch hole 23.
The safety cover 3 covers the top of the aging box 2. When the safety cover 3 is covered on the aging box 2, the pressure probe 34 is inserted into the switch hole 23 of the aging plate 21, and the second power switch 222 is closed; when the safety cover 3 is away from the aging box 2, the pressure probe 34 exits the switch hole 23 and the second power switch 222 is turned off.
The utility model discloses an operation process of ageing equipment as follows:
1. the lamp beads are fixed on the aging board 21;
2. the safety cover 3 is covered on the top of the aging box 2;
3. when the first power switch button 10 of the power supply main unit 1 is pressed, the test circuit 22 is connected to the power supply main unit 1, and the burn-in box 2 starts a burn-in test.
